Seven-card stud poker is a popular variant of the game of poker. In this game, each player is dealt seven cards, and the objective is to make the best five-card hand possible. While the traditional name for this game is "seven-card stud poker," there are a number of synonyms that are commonly used to refer to it. Some of these synonyms include "high-stakes stud," "seven-card stud high," and "seven-stud." Other variations on the game include "seven-card stud eight or better," "razz," and "stud hi-lo."
